For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Sunil Kumar Yadav, Adv For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. Sri Asharaf Ansari, APP 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E BIRENDRA KUMAR ORAL ORDER 19-04-2018 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ned APP for the State.
Petitioner seeks bail in a case registered for the offences punishable under Sections 304(B)/34 of the Indian Penal Code and 3/4 of Dowry Prohibition Act. The petitioner is elder brother of the victim of dowry death. There is general and omnibus allegation of demand of dowry and torture for the same. Petitioner is in custody since 27.12.2017. The husband of the victim is already in custody.
Considering the general and omnibus nature of allegation, let the petitioner, above named, be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s.20,000/- (Twenty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.21972 of 2018 (2) dt.19-04-2018 satisfaction of learned Court below where the case is pending in connection with Sasaram (Bhabhua) Rail Police Station Case No.95 of 2017, subject to the condition that the petitioner shall fully cooperate with the trial of the case, failing which the court below shall be at liberty to cancel the bail bond of the petitioner.
